The The Equity of Jensen-Group (JEN.BR) as of Aug 19, 2026 is 303.37 M EUR. In the previous year, The Equity was 282.62 M EUR — a change of 7.34% (higher).

What does Jensen-Group do? The Jensen Group NV is one of the leading companies in the manufacturing and supply of industrial laundry solutions worldwide. Founded in Denmark in 1937, the company has representations in more than 50 countries and employs more than 2,500 employees. With the development of new, innovative technologies and the constant optimization of its processes, the Jensen Group NV has earned an excellent reputation as a trusted partner for customers around the world. The business model of the Jensen Group NV is to provide companies in the textile industry with state-of-the-art laundry facilities, software, and service solutions, thereby ensuring greater efficiency and profitability in the field of laundry technology. The company also offers comprehensive consulting and training for the proper application, maintenance, and repair of its products. Overall, the Jensen Group NV focuses on a very close and personal collaboration with its customers and is always striving to individually meet their wishes and needs. The Jensen Group NV is divided into five different business areas. These include 1. Procurement and manufacturing, 2. Laundry service, 3. Equipment and software sales, 4. Spare parts delivery, and 5. Financial and IT services. In the procurement and manufacturing sector, the Jensen Group NV offers everything related to the construction of laundry facilities. From the planning and manufacturing of customized systems for commercial laundry to the sale of finished products, the company provides solutions for every need – ranging from small family businesses to industrial enterprises. In the laundry service business area, the Jensen Group NV offers its customers a complete range of laundry service solutions. The range of services includes production lines and rental models, as well as fleet management software and maintenance services. In the equipment and software sales sector, the Jensen Group NV offers a wide range of machines and software solutions that help customers increase their productivity and profitability in the field of laundry technology. This includes products such as washing machines, dryers, ironing machines, presses, and software solutions for controlling and monitoring laundry technology. In the spare parts delivery sector, the Jensen Group NV provides fast and reliable delivery of spare parts for all of its products. Whether it's small parts or complex system components, the Jensen Group NV ensures that its customers can quickly put their laundry facilities into operation, even if something breaks. In the final sector of financial and IT services, the Jensen Group NV offers additional services such as financing and insurance packages, as well as solutions for the automation of laundry processes. The company can draw on its years of experience in the field of laundry technology and thus offer its customers a complete all-round solution. In summary, the Jensen Group NV offers a wide range of products and services, making it the ideal partner for all companies looking to modernize or optimize their laundry technology. Analyzing Jensen-Group's Equity

Jensen-Group's equity represents the ownership interest in the company, calculated as the difference between total assets and total liabilities. It reflects the residual claim by shareholders on the company’s assets after all debts have been paid. Understanding Jensen-Group's equity is essential for assessing its financial health, stability, and value to shareholders.

Year-to-Year Comparison

Evaluating Jensen-Group's equity over successive years offers insights into the company's growth, profitability, and capital structure. Increasing equity indicates an enhancement in net assets and financial health, while decreasing equity could point to rising debts or operational challenges.

Impact on Investments

Jensen-Group's equity is a crucial element for investors, influencing the company's leverage, risk profile, and return on equity (ROE). Higher equity levels generally suggest lower risk and enhanced financial stability, making the company a potentially attractive investment opportunity.

Interpreting Equity Fluctuations

Fluctuations in Jensen-Group’s equity can arise from various factors, including changes in net income, dividend payments, and issuance or buyback of shares. Investors analyze these shifts to gauge the company's financial performance, operational efficiency, and strategic financial management.
